Ticket: DeployBot for the Marrowline pipeline rejected the 3.1.7 status payload with SIG_INVALID. Webhook messages from the orchestrator are signed; verification began failing after last night's rotation. Bot config still references the retired key, so every deploy-status post to the Tidewell channel is dropped. No evidence of tampering — hashes match, only the key mismatch. Fix is to update the bot's verification config to the current rotation. The active signing key is below.

signing key of bahif-fahif = bky6_bSJfRS

## v2.8.1 — Tilecrest Cache Layer

Reworked eviction logic in the Mapwright tile-rendering cache. Tiles are now evicted by weighted age and render cost rather than plain LRU, which cut re-render load on the Ostrobay cluster by roughly a third. Added a warm-up pass on deploy so popular zoom levels are pre-seeded. Contractors touching this code should read the eviction notes in the internal wiki first. Questions about this change should go to the engineer identified below.

account owner for bawip-tahag: Raleth Quenok

## Runbook: Quillpress Markdown Pipeline — Render Node Recovery

If the Quillpress renderer reports stale sanitizer rules, drain the render queue, then restart the sanitizer sidecar before the main process. The sidecar authenticates to the internal rules service on boot; without a valid credential it falls back to cached rules silently. Confirm the node uses the current key, shown below.

gateway credential: kto15_RZiI2tlM0JrWPyf

Handover — Vexler partner SFTP drop

Ownership moves to you today. Drop runs hourly from Vexler's end into the intake bucket via the relay host. Watch for zero-byte files; their exporter flakes on Mondays. Creds live in the ops vault, path noted in the runbook. Vault auto-seals after 48h idle. Support escalations go to the on-call rotation, not me. If the vault is sealed when you need it, unseal with the recovery passphrase below.

recovery phrase for tadug-fafof: zorwyn-kasion